Obstructive Sleep Apnea (OSA) is primarily a physical, structural issue. When you enter deep sleep, the muscles supporting the soft tissues in your throat relax, causing the upper airway to narrow or collapse entirely. While non-invasive positive airway pressure therapies effectively act as a pneumatic splint, some patients present with severe, localized anatomical blockages that complicate standard management.
Sleep Apnoea Surgery includes various specialized procedures designed to alter, clear, or bypass these physical obstructions. Rather than being a primary treatment for everyone, surgical intervention is a highly selective option. It is typically considered when there are clear structural issues, such as enlarged tonsils or distinct jaw misalignment, or when non-surgical treatments have not provided sufficient relief.

If surgery is indicated, the procedure is selected to target the exact area of your airway obstruction. Common surgical options include:
Trims, reshapes, or repositions excess tissue at the back of the throat—such as a portion of the soft palate and uvula—to widen the airway and reduce tissue vibration.
Surgically removes enlarged tonsils or adenoids that are physically blocking the upper airway. This is a highly effective procedure when tissue enlargement is the primary cause of obstruction.
Procedures like septoplasty or turbinate reduction clear nasal passages by straightening a deviated septum, making it easier to breathe through the nose during sleep.
A more involved structural procedure that carefully brings the upper and lower jaws forward. This movement pulls the attached soft tissues forward, significantly enlarging the airway space behind the tongue.
Having realistic expectations is important when considering surgical options. Below is an overview of what procedures can achieve and the limitations to keep in mind:
| Potential Clinical Benefits | Key Clinical Limitations |
|---|---|
• Reduces Obstructions: Helps clear identified physical blockages within the upper respiratory tract. • Symptom Relief: Can lead to noticeable reductions in chronic snoring and breathing pauses. • Less Treatment Reliance: May lower a patient's long-term dependence on CPAP machines if the procedure is highly successful. • Permanent Adaptation: Provides a structural adjustment, eliminating the need to use an external device every night. | • Variable Outcomes: Results can vary based on individual healing and complex airway shapes, meaning sleep apnoea may not fully resolve. • Continued Device Use: Some patients may still need to use low-pressure CPAP or oral appliances even after surgery. • Recovery Considerations: Requires an intentional recovery period with temporary post-operative discomfort during tissue healing. • Anatomy Restrictions: Not suitable for non-anatomical sleep conditions or central sleep apnoea. |

Surgery is one part of an ongoing care plan. Proper recovery and monitoring are essential for achieving the best possible long-term results:
⚠️Healing Timelines: Recovery can range from a few weeks to over a month, depending on the complexity of the procedure.
⚠️Follow-Up Care: Regular check-ins are scheduled to monitor tissue healing and track your physical comfort.
⚠️Follow-Up Sleep Study: A new sleep study is typically scheduled a few months later to objectively check if your breathing patterns have improved.
⚠️Ongoing Wellness Support: Maintaining healthy sleep habits and weight management remains important for preventing the return of symptoms.

Sleep apnoea surgery encompasses a range of specialized surgical procedures designed to modify, reposition, or remove specific tissues within the upper respiratory tract. The goal is to clear structural blockages that cause Obstructive Sleep Apnea (OSA) when non-invasive interventions have proved unsuccessful.
Surgery is generally reserved for patients who have clear anatomical airway obstructions (such as severely hypertrophied tonsils, a deviated nasal septum, or a retrognathic jaw position) or those who are completely unable to tolerate positive airway pressure (PAP) therapy despite extensive troubleshooting.
CPAP therapy remains the international gold standard first-line treatment for moderate-to-severe OSA due to its non-invasive nature and high efficacy. Surgery is not universally 'better'; it is a highly selective alternative meant for specific structural abnormalities or therapy-resistant cases.
While surgery can significantly widen the airway, improve airflow, and reduce the Apnea-Hypopnea Index (AHI), it does not guarantee a total cure. Sleep apnoea is complex and multifactorial; some patients may still require low-level positional or PAP support after their procedure.
A follow-up sleep study (polysomnography) is typically performed a few months after tissue healing is complete. This provides objective data on your breathing metrics, confirming how effectively the physical blockage was resolved and checking for any lingering sleep disruptions.
